Experties


  • Multidisciplinary Chemistry
  • Synthesis, characterization and exploration of diverse properties of different single- crystalline or polycrystalline inorganic- organic hybrids. Trained in wide range of instrumental and measurement techniques related to both solids and solutions. Doctoral work primarily focused on gas sorption, photoluminescence, magnetic properties of metal-organic framework and catalysis by nanomaterials.
